Cecil Township is a growing municipality in Washington County along the Route 50 corridor west of Canonsburg, bordering Peters Township and Allegheny County’s South Hills. It’s a community of farms transitioning to suburban development, established neighborhoods, and the mix of older and newer housing stock that defines Washington County’s Pittsburgh-adjacent communities. Route 50 runs east-west through Cecil Township connecting to Canonsburg and the Allegheny County line. Millers Run Road, Cecil-Bishop Road, and the network of township roads connect the community. Cecil has a mix of older farmhouse-adjacent properties on larger lots and newer subdivision development.
Cecil Township has two distinct housing eras. The older properties — farmhouses and early 20th century homes on larger parcels — reflect Washington County’s agricultural roots. The newer subdivision housing dates primarily from the 1990s and 2000s. Both eras present maintenance realities: older properties with significant deferred maintenance, newer homes now hitting their first major mechanical replacement cycles.

What a Cash Offer Actually Nets You in Cecil PA
A cash offer on your home will be below retail — we are not going to tell you otherwise. But the gap between a cash offer and what you actually net on a traditional sale is smaller than most sellers expect. A conventional sale involves agent commissions (5–6%), repair costs to make the home showable, carrying costs while it sits on market, and the real probability of a deal falling through at inspection or financing. When you run that math honestly, the net difference is often a few thousand dollars — and in exchange, you get certainty, speed, and no management headaches.
